In 2019-2020, 77,593 people earned their degree in allied health and medical assisting services, making the major the 33rd most popular in the United States. In 2017-2018, allied health and medical assisting services graduates who were awarded their degree in 2015-2017, earned an average of $26,454 and had an average of $15,514 in loans still to pay off.

Across Georgia, there were 2,828 allied health and medical assisting services graduates with average earnings and debt of $29,393 and $20,802 respectively. At the associate degree level specifically, there were 376 allied health and medical assisting services graduates with average earnings and debt of $31,274 and $19,485 respectively.
